If you're noticing that your knee is swelling, you may want to try self-care measures first. Ice and rest will often help the swelling go down and the pain to subside. However, you should make an appointment with Crescent City Orthopedics right away if you notice:
These are signs that something more serious is going on, and the sooner you get medical help, the better. If possible, avoid putting weight on your knee while waiting for your appointment.
If your swollen knee doesn't resolve with ice and rest, it's a sign that you have something else going on. Often this is due to a fracture of one of the bones in or around the knee or a tear in the soft tissue of the knee.
